Perches are essential for laying hen welfare, satisfying roosting motivation and building bone density, but poor design causes the keel bone fractures that affect the majority of hens.
Perch design represents a genuine welfare tradeoff — perches are essential for behavioral welfare (satisfying roosting motivation and building bone strength) but poorly designed perches contribute to the keel bone fracture epidemic in laying hens. Round perches at inappropriate heights with inadequate spacing cause collision injuries during the landing approach and uncomfortable grasping angles. Oval or flat perches, appropriate ramp access, and careful height spacing reduce fracture incidence while maintaining behavioral benefit. The goal is perches that hens actively want to use, can access safely, and can sleep on comfortably without injury — a design challenge that welfare science is progressively solving.
